ANDERS ZORN –
Rosita Mauri, 1891
Etching
Sheet size: 275 x 180 mm
Image size: 222 x 158 mm
Edition: c.1500 – Signed in plate
Original etching by Anders Zorn printed in bistre on laid paper, tipped in to the Gazette des Beaux-Arts. Signed in the plate. This is Anders Zorn's most iconic image, an etching after his painting of 1889. It depicts the dancer Rosita Mauri, who was also painted by Degas. There was a signed edition of 70 of this etching, copies of which reach very high prices (one sold at auction for $6,480 in 1992); Delteil gives a figure of 1500 proofs for this later printing in the Gazette. Ref: Sanchez & Seydoux 1891-5; Delteil no.34 (IV/V); Asplund 34; Hjert & Hjert 27. Condition: Fine.
